Output 31f7e17a64113c49fcb9145d3e0c51e0df989d709872db34dc96aafed2b125ed:2

value
50696966
script pubkey
OP_0 OP_PUSHBYTES_20 65328382c006070cc0bb45ea8b0d2de93b6001db
address
ltc1qv5eg8qkqqcrses9mgh4gkrfdayakqqwm77uzxm
transaction
31f7e17a64113c49fcb9145d3e0c51e0df989d709872db34dc96aafed2b125ed
spent
true